Description
Excellence
Review and analyze member posts to initiate cases
Perform data entry processing
Process system data updates such as member and beneficiary records
Generate quotations, run calculations, and produce correspondence for scheme members.
Identify areas where service to clients/members could be improved and communicate to Team Leader
Know and live the firm’s values
Monitor own workflow to ensure service levels are achieved (quality, efficiency, timeliness)
Comply with ISO 9001, ISO 27001 and Professional Excellence standards
